WebSep 17, 2024 · To set up an automatic end date, head to Microsoft Forms, sign in, and open your form. Click More form settings (three dots) on the top right of your form and pick Settings. Mark the option for ... WebNov 13, 2024 · Go to Microsoft Forms. Click the form and then click on Responses. Click on Open in Excel button. Open the Excel file, and then click on Enable Editing button. Select Get response … fly feats pathfinderWebSep 5, 2024 · To add an attachment to a form, you just need to add a new question, and then specify the type of File Upload control. The process is simple. Within your form: Click Add new Click the drop down menu for additional options (if file upload is not shown) Click on file upload With your new control added, click OK to complete your form. fly feat. summer hazeWebFeb 6, 2024 · A fast way to do this is to click File menu, then click the path and click Copy path to clipboard.
